#e69f35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e69f35 is composed of 90.2% red, 62.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 77%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 35.9 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 55.5%. #e69f35 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#cd3f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#e69f35 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e69f35 has RGB values of R:230, G:159,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.77,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15114037.

Shades and Tints of #e69f35
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e69f35
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8e8c is the less saturated color, while #f7a224 is the most saturated one.
